Climate
In Puno, summers are short, cool and cloudy; winters are short, very cold and mostly clear, and it is dry throughout the year. During the course of the year, the temperature usually varies from -4 °C to 17 °C and rarely drops to less than -6 °C , or rise over 19 °C.
